More than 5bn items shipped with Amazon Prime in 2017

Amazon has announced that more than 5bn items were shipped through its Prime service in 2017.

This included free same-day, one-day, and two-day shipping.

In a statement issued on Tuesday (2 January), Greg Greeley, Vice President, Amazon Prime, also claimed that more new paid members joined Prime worldwide in 2017 than any previous year. The Prime service is now available in 16 countries.

The Amazon statement added: ” In 2017, the Amazon fulfillment and shipping network increased by more than 30% in square footage worldwide. In the U.S. alone, more than 6,000 trailers and 32 Amazon Air planes were in place to serve Prime members during the year.”
